Edey has skills and is limited … and maybe gets picked in the 1st by a better team as a back-up big.
Boban (who I really like) has made a career because he works hard.

Clingan, OTOH, is a rim protector AND gets tough blocks. Watching him a bit, he’s not twitchy athletic but he looks like an effective center in today’s NBA. A guy who can hedge and get back. He has work to do, but I won’t be surprised to see him gone prior to the Warriors pick. At 7’2 and his level of mobility he’s an actual shot blocker — not an athletic big who SHOULD be a shot blocker! He’s got value.
